From 7bb057b85a947e4fecef7a6f443f45282ea63de1 Mon Sep 17 00:00:00 2001 From: Mike Jancar Date: Fri, 25 Feb 2022 10:08:51 -0500 Subject: [PATCH] docs: beef up package info --- package-lock.json | 122 ++++++++++++++++++++++++++++++++ package.json | 2 + projects/oculr-ngx/README.md | 1 - projects/oculr-ngx/package.json | 11 +++ 4 files changed, 135 insertions(+), 1 deletion(-) delete mode 100644 projects/oculr-ngx/README.md diff --git a/package-lock.json b/package-lock.json index 7009e5a..507a7ba 100644 --- a/package-lock.json +++ b/package-lock.json @@ -5727,6 +5727,38 @@ } } }, + "copyfiles": { + "version": "2.4.1", + "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/copyfiles/-/copyfiles-2.4.1.tgz", + "integrity": "sha512-fereAvAvxDrQDOXybk3Qu3dPbOoKoysFMWtkY3mv5BsL8//OSZVL5DCLYqgRfY5cWirgRzlC+WSrxp6Bo3eNZg==", + "dev": true, + "requires": { + "glob": "^7.0.5", + "minimatch": "^3.0.3", + "mkdirp": "^1.0.4", + "noms": "0.0.0", + "through2": "^2.0.1", + "untildify": "^4.0.0", + "yargs": "^16.1.0" + }, + "dependencies": { + "yargs": { + "version": "16.2.0", + "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/yargs/-/yargs-16.2.0.tgz", + "integrity": "sha512-D1mvvtDG0L5ft/jGWkLpG1+m0eQxOfaBvTNELraWj22wSVUMWxZUvYgJYcKh6jGGIkJFhH4IZPQhR4TKpc8mBw==", + "dev": true, + "requires": { + "cliui": "^7.0.2", + "escalade": "^3.1.1", + "get-caller-file": "^2.0.5", + "require-directory": "^2.1.1", + "string-width": "^4.2.0", + "y18n": "^5.0.5", + "yargs-parser": "^20.2.2" + } + } + } + }, "core-js": { "version": "3.16.0", "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/core-js/-/core-js-3.16.0.tgz", @@ -9946,6 +9978,42 @@ "find-parent-dir": "^0.3.0" } }, + "noms": { + "version": "0.0.0", + "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/noms/-/noms-0.0.0.tgz", + "integrity": "sha1-2o69nzr51nYJGbJ9nNyAkqczKFk=", + "dev": true, + "requires": { + "inherits": "^2.0.1", + "readable-stream": "~1.0.31" + }, + "dependencies": { + "isarray": { + "version": "0.0.1", + "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/isarray/-/isarray-0.0.1.tgz", + "integrity": "sha1-ihis/Kmo9Bd+Cav8YDiTmwXR7t8=", + "dev": true + }, + "readable-stream": { + "version": "1.0.34", + "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/readable-stream/-/readable-stream-1.0.34.tgz", + "integrity": "sha1-Elgg40vIQtLyqq+v5MKRbuMsFXw=", + "dev": true, + "requires": { + "core-util-is": "~1.0.0", + "inherits": "~2.0.1", + "isarray": "0.0.1", + "string_decoder": "~0.10.x" + } + }, + "string_decoder": { + "version": "0.10.31", + "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/string_decoder/-/string_decoder-0.10.31.tgz", + "integrity": "sha1-YuIDvEF2bGwoyfyEMB2rHFMQ+pQ=", + "dev": true + } + } + }, "nopt": { "version": "5.0.0", "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/nopt/-/nopt-5.0.0.tgz", @@ -13458,6 +13526,48 @@ "integrity": "sha1-DdTJ/6q8NXlgsbckEV1+Doai4fU=", "dev": true }, + "through2": { + "version": "2.0.5", + "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/through2/-/through2-2.0.5.tgz", + "integrity": "sha512-/mrRod8xqpA+IHSLyGCQ2s8SPHiCDEeQJSep1jqLYeEUClOFG2Qsh+4FU6G9VeqpZnGW/Su8LQGc4YKni5rYSQ==", + "dev": true, + "requires": { + "readable-stream": "~2.3.6", + "xtend": "~4.0.1" + }, + "dependencies": { + "readable-stream": { + "version": "2.3.7", + "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/readable-stream/-/readable-stream-2.3.7.tgz", + "integrity": "sha512-Ebho8K4jIbHAxnuxi7o42OrZgF/ZTNcsZj6nRKyUmkhLFq8CHItp/fy6hQZuZmP/n3yZ9VBUbp4zz/mX8hmYPw==", + "dev": true, + "requires": { + "core-util-is": "~1.0.0", + "inherits": "~2.0.3", + "isarray": "~1.0.0", + "process-nextick-args": "~2.0.0", + "safe-buffer": "~5.1.1", + "string_decoder": "~1.1.1", + "util-deprecate": "~1.0.1" + } + }, + "safe-buffer": { + "version": "5.1.2", + "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/safe-buffer/-/safe-buffer-5.1.2.tgz", + "integrity": "sha512-Gd2UZBJDkXlY7GbJxfsE8/nvKkUEU1G38c1siN6QP6a9PT9MmHB8GnpscSmMJSoF8LOIrt8ud/wPtojys4G6+g==", + "dev": true + }, + "string_decoder": { + "version": "1.1.1", + "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/string_decoder/-/string_decoder-1.1.1.tgz", + "integrity": "sha512-n/ShnvDi6FHbbVfviro+WojiFzv+s8MPMHBczVePfUpDJLwoLT0ht1l4YwBCbi8pJAveEEdnkHyPyTP/mzRfwg==", + "dev": true, + "requires": { + "safe-buffer": "~5.1.0" + } + } + } + }, "thunky": { "version": "1.1.0", "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/thunky/-/thunky-1.1.0.tgz", @@ -13707,6 +13817,12 @@ } } }, + "untildify": { + "version": "4.0.0", + "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/untildify/-/untildify-4.0.0.tgz", + "integrity": "sha512-KK8xQ1mkzZeg9inewmFVDNkg3l5LUhoq9kN6iWYB/CC9YMG8HA+c1Q8HwDe6dEX7kErrEVNVBO3fWsVq5iDgtw==", + "dev": true + }, "upath": { "version": "1.2.0", "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/upath/-/upath-1.2.0.tgz", @@ -14453,6 +14569,12 @@ "integrity": "sha1-Y6VkVtsbBDZ9C3IaC4DK5ti+y7o=", "dev": true }, + "xtend": { + "version": "4.0.2", + "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/xtend/-/xtend-4.0.2.tgz", + "integrity": "sha512-LKYU1iAXJXUgAXn9URjiu+MWhyUXHsvfp7mcuYm9dSUKK0/CjtrUwFAxD82/mCWbtLsGjFIad0wIsod4zrTAEQ==", + "dev": true + }, "xxhashjs": { "version": "0.2.2", "resolved": "https://progressive.jfrog.io/progressive/api/npm/pgr-npm/xxhashjs/-/xxhashjs-0.2.2.tgz", diff --git a/package.json b/package.json index 64fdf19..f0067a9 100644 --- a/package.json +++ b/package.json @@ -8,6 +8,7 @@ "start": "ng serve", "build": "ng build", "watch": "ng build --watch --configuration development", + "postbuild": "copyfiles LICENSE.md README.md dist/oculr-ngx", "test": "ng test", "test:ci": "ng test --configuration production", "test:dev": "ng test --configuration development", @@ -39,6 +40,7 @@ "@types/node": "^12.20.42", "@typescript-eslint/eslint-plugin": "4.28.2", "@typescript-eslint/parser": "4.28.2", + "copyfiles": "^2.4.1", "eslint": "^7.26.0", "jasmine-core": "~3.8.0", "karma": "^6.3.11", diff --git a/projects/oculr-ngx/README.md b/projects/oculr-ngx/README.md deleted file mode 100644 index 0c2dc2f..0000000 --- a/projects/oculr-ngx/README.md +++ /dev/null @@ -1 +0,0 @@ -# oculr-ngx diff --git a/projects/oculr-ngx/package.json b/projects/oculr-ngx/package.json index 33f9d35..6455f15 100644 --- a/projects/oculr-ngx/package.json +++ b/projects/oculr-ngx/package.json @@ -1,6 +1,17 @@ { "name": "oculr-ngx", + "description": "An analytics library that makes collecting data in an Angular app simple.", "version": "1.0.0-rc2", + "author": "Progressive Insurance", + "license": "MIT", + "keywords": [ + "analytics", + "angular" + ], + "repository": { + "type": "git", + "url": "https://github.com/Progressive-Insurance/oculr-ngx" + }, "scripts": { "tag-release": "git commit -a -m \"Release %npm_package_version%\" && git tag \"v%npm_package_version%\"" },